new pageB()加不加new 都没影响

来源:4-3 代码封装

moonstar

2015-12-20 12:41

我试过将new去掉 alert()一样回执行

那么这里的new是什么

写回答 关注

3回答

  • 逯子洋
    2015-12-20 14:03:43

    function Test() {  

      this.name = 'Test';  

      return 'Test';  

    }  

    var fnT = Test();  console.log(fnT.name);//undefined

    var newT = new Test();  console.log(newT.name);//Test

    new 的作用是先声明一个对象,然后调用pageB作为初始化函数。

    这样的好处是可以调用pageB里的属性方法

  • moonstar
    2015-12-20 13:53:49

    thank you

    李晓健

    没有其他问题,就把这个问题关掉吧

    2015-12-20 14:15:51

    共 1 条回复 >

  • 李晓健
    2015-12-20 13:37:58

H5+JS+CSS3 实现圣诞情缘

为圣诞节准备的H5+JS+CSS特效案例教程,实现静与动的结合

122015 学习 · 211 问题

查看课程

相似问题